APPARATUS AND METHOD FOR CIGARETTE FILTER INSERTION
20250374953 · 2025-12-11 ·

A cigarette filter insertion apparatus and method are provided for automated cigarette production. The apparatus comprises at least one filter delivery tube, a filter positioner with a passage terminating at a stop face, and a detainer yoke movable between obstructing and permitting filter movement. The detainer yoke includes a gate and a compliant detainer, such as a spring-biased pogo pin, to frictionally engage filters and prevent multiple filters from advancing. An actuator, such as a solenoid, controls the detainer yoke, and an air assist port delivers a puff of air to advance a single filter. Photodetectors may monitor filter position and synchronize filter release and air assist. The passage may include slots to vent excess air and minimize filter disturbance. The apparatus deposits filters into a trough formed in a belt for subsequent encapsulation. The method includes conveying, detaining, actuating, air-assisted advancement, and controlled release of cigarette filters.
